Retainer Wear Guidelines
To maintain your newly straightened teeth, follow these essential retainer wear standards after finishing your Invisalign therapy. Your retainer is critical in ensuring that your teeth remain in their fixed placements. Originally, wear your retainer for a minimum of 22 hours a day, only removing it for meals and dental health regimens. This consistent wear helps maintain the teeth in their brand-new positioning and stops them from changing back.
After the first few months, you can progressively shift to putting on the retainer only at night while you sleep. Nonetheless, it's important to continue wearing it every night for the long-lasting to preserve your outcomes. Remember to cleanse your retainer frequently with a soft toothbrush and moderate soap to stop the accumulation of microorganisms and plaque.
Additionally, shop your retainer in its situation whenever you're not wearing it to stay clear of misplacement or damage. If you experience any type of issues or notice modifications in exactly how your retainer fits, contact your orthodontist promptly for adjustments.
Oral Health Finest Practices
Preserve optimum oral wellness by practicing proper health behaviors to take care of your teeth and gums effectively. Brush your teeth at the very least two times a day making use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. look at this web-site in mind to clean for two minutes each time, making certain to get to all surface areas of your teeth.
Floss daily to eliminate plaque and food fragments from in between your teeth where your tooth brush can not get to. Take into consideration utilizing an antimicrobial mouthwash to help reduce bacteria in your mouth and freshen your breath.
In addition to your everyday regimen, bear in mind to cleanse your retainer or aligner routinely to avoid germs buildup. Use a mild cleanser suggested by your orthodontist and comply with the directions provided.
Stay hydrated by consuming a lot of water throughout the day to assist get rid of food debris and keep your mouth moist. Limitation sweet and acidic foods and drinks that can add to dental cavity.
Routine Oral Check-Ups
Regular dental check-ups are vital for preserving the wellness and positioning of your teeth after Invisalign therapy. These exams aid your dental practitioner monitor your teeth placement and bite feature, dealing with any type of issues promptly. By scheduling routine check outs, you can stop problems from intensifying and preserve the results of your Invisalign therapy.
Throughout these consultations, your dental practitioner will certainly do a comprehensive examination of your teeth and periodontals to spot degeneration, gum condition, or other oral wellness concerns. They will certainly likewise examine the positioning of your teeth to ensure they remain in their remedied placements post-Invisalign. Expert cleanings may be advised to remove plaque and tartar accumulation that regular oral health techniques may miss out on.
